Some of the country’s top Native American artists are in Tulsa this weekend for the Mvskoke (Muscogee) Art Market.

Visitors can explore Native art from nearly 100 artists, featuring everything from paintings and pottery to jewelry and sculpture. The event also includes lectures and hands-on activities.

Artist Starr Hardridge won Best in Show for his piece titled "Peaceful Sunrise."

"It features these two sacred egret white crane birds. The painting represents unity and peace and balance and harmony," Hardridge said.

For those who missed the market on Saturday, it continues Sunday from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. at the River Spirit Casino Resort.
